Download NowNEW DELHI: Madhya Pradesh Board of Secondary Education (MPBSE) is all set to announce Class 10 board exam result 2022 today. The online MP Board Class 10th result 2022 will be published on official website and other websites. Students will have to enter their roll number and application number to check MP Board 10th result 2022 online .

The online mark sheet will be provisional for immediate information and original mark sheet will be sent through respective schools.
MP Board 10th Result 2022 Date and Time
-
Exam date: February 18 to March 10, 2022
-
Result date: April 29, 2022
-
Result Time: 1 pm
Last year, the board announced the Class 10 exam result on July 14, 2021 at 4 pm. All students were promoted to the next class.
